Ticket #977 — FuelTally sandbox env is half-baked. Hey plugin folks — a few of you flagged that the fleet fuel-usage report endpoint in the FuelTally sandbox returns 401s no matter what. Turns out the sandbox env file shipped without the reporting API credential, so your plugins were never going to authenticate. Quick fix on your side: open your local fueltally.env, make sure REPORT_WINDOW_DAYS=30 is set, then drop the reporting secret on the very next line.

env line for yahip-tafog: RELAY_SECRET3=4ca

## Limits and quotas

The Duskrun scheduler launches nightly backfill jobs in priority order, capped by per-tenant concurrency and a global worker pool. Jobs exceeding the wall-clock limit are preempted and requeued at lower priority; three preemptions mark a job as stalled for manual review. Quota changes take effect at the next scheduling window, never mid-run. When adjusting these, keep the global pool above the sum of tenant caps. Current limits follow.

tuning constants:
RATE_LIMITS = {
    "wenwyn": 1,
    "zorix": 10,
    "oliix": 2,
    "holael": 10,
}

The Pairwise matching service has triggered repeated alerts for garbage-collection pauses exceeding 800ms during peak matching windows. Pauses of this length cause match requests to time out upstream in the Corvid gateway, which retries and amplifies load. Current suspicion is heap pressure from the candidate-cache rewrite shipped two weeks ago. Mitigation so far: heap size increased 25% on the Brindlemoor cluster, which reduced but did not eliminate the spikes. Full pause histograms and tuning notes are collected on the dashboard page below.

runbook for hahap-baduf: https://jira.qorvelsys.internal/projects/projects/pages/projects/c0cb

**Document Transport — Print Masters**

Master copies for Gantrell Print Works must never travel by regular post. Each master is placed in a rigid folder, sealed with numbered tape, and logged in the transport register by the office manager. Only one set of masters may be in transit at any time; duplicates stay in the fire safe. Collections are handled by Redquill Couriers under standing contract, mornings only. At the point of collection, the courier must receive the following confidential instruction:

handover note for yagef-bagep: the drudor pelius courier leaves the kasdor zorvan norir ledger at gate 8016 under passcode 755406